Transportation to Airport from Catania City Center

Fontanarossa Airport

There are various transportation options you can prefer to travel between the city center and Fontanarossa Airport. You can easily get to the airport from the city center by choosing from the taxi, bus or car rental options.

Taxi

You can get to Fontanarossa Airport fast and easily by a taxi you can call or take from anywhere in Catania city. Taking a taxi could be an extremely easy option for you to reach Fontanarossa Airport, which is only 4 kilometers away from the city center.

Bus

You can go to Fontanarossa Airport easily and economically by the buses you can get from all parts of the city. Buses, which are more affordable than taking a taxi, are available on many different lines. Depending on where you are, the buses will take you to Fontanarossa Airport easily.

Rent a car

One of the cozy alternatives you can prefer to get to Fontanarossa Airport is the car rental option. You can easily catch your flight thanks to the cars you can rent from the offices of the car rental companies in the city center. Please keep in mind that you can rent a car with or without a driver. Among the car rental companies you can choose from are AP Transfers, Forzese, Hertz, Holiday, Hollywood, Italy and Locauto.

Airport Information

Fontanarossa Airport, the busiest airport in Catania located in Italy's Sicily Autonomous Region, serves internationally and is an important airport that is only 4 kilometers away. Fontanarossa Airport, which is the sixth busiest airport in Italy, hosts a large number of passengers each year and plays a major role in Italy's air transportation.

You can take advantage of numerous services offered to you in the terminal buildings of Fontanarossa Airport. You can enjoy your time in stylish and cozy lounges, complete your money transactions at bank offices, or get emergency medical help when needed.

In addition to these, you can also do shopping or have something to eat or drink at the terminal buildings where many services such as car rental offices, lost property office, and postal services are offered for your convenience.

Among the shopping stores at Fontanarossa Airport are D&D, Aldeasa Italia Srl, Rapisarda, Sicilia Arte, Aeronautica Militare, Camomilla Italia and Occhialeria Angiolucci.

Culto, Sicilia’s, Sfizio, I dolci di Nonna Vincenza, Autogrill Restaurant and Bricca-Puro Gusto are among the places where you can meet your eating and drinking needs at the airport's food court.

Transportation to Marseille City Center from Airport

Marseille Provence Airport

The Provence Airport is 27 kilometers away from the city center in Marseille, which is the center of the Provence Alpes Cote d’azur region in France. Provence Airport, which is among France's busiest 50 airports, is also the third largest airport in terms of air freight transportation traffic in France.

Provence Airport offers a large number of alternatives for transportation to and from the city center as well as ample parking spaces at terminal building for those who want to travel by their own cars.

You can take advantage of different transportation alternatives to reach the city center from Provence Airport, which is 27 kilometers away from Marseille city center. It is possible to go to the city center by choosing from the options such as taxi, train, bus, transfer vehicle and car rental.

Taxi

You can comfortably get to the city center by taking a taxi from Provence Airport, which provides you this service with 86 taxis each day of the week and every hour of the day. You can pay cash or by credit card as well as you can pay by check; if you want to find out about taxi fare, you can find information at the website of the airport.

Train

It is possible to reach the city center in about 20 minutes by train that you can take at the entrance building of Provence Airport. It is very easy to go to the city center by getting train tickets from ticket sales office. A total of 66 trains are at your service from 6 am to 10 pm every day at Provence Airport.

Bus

You can also get to the city center from Provence Airport by bus, which is another option as public transportation, without having any difficulty. You will arrive at the city center in about 20 minutes by taking a bus at the entrance of the airport.

Transfer Vehicle

Transfer vehicles are at your service as a transportation service offered to you by the hotel you have agreed with. You can easily get to your hotel from Provence Airport by the transfer vehicle that your hotel offers to you.

Rent a car

The last option to get to the city center from Provence Airport is to rent a car. You can reach the city center after a journey that takes about 15 minutes by renting a car from the car rental companies such as Avis, Budget, Enterprise, Europcar, Interrent, Firefly, Sixt and Hertz at the airport.
